World Radio Day: A Brief History of Radio Broadcasting

Radio broadcasting showcases human ingenuity, using electromagnetic waves to connect people globally. On this World Radio Day, Let's trace its history from inception to modern significance.

Origins And Innovations

Marconi's experiments paved the way for radio communication. Rapid technological advancements refined transmitters and receivers.

Golden Age Impact

Radio became a dominant mass medium, shaping cultural experiences. It played a crucial role in wartime propaganda and fostered innovation in storytelling.

Challenge of Television

Television's rise posed a threat due to its immense popularity among people, leading radio to adapt to music formats and diverse programming.

Digital Revolution

The shift to digital transmission brought about satellite radio, internet streaming, and podcasting, democratizing the medium.

Enduring Legacy

Despite technological changes, radio remains resilient, continuing to inform, entertain, and connect communities globally.
